India will face England in the 20th match of the Women’s World Cup 2025 on Sunday, October 19, at the Holkar Cricket Stadium in Indore. India have won and lost two matches each so far. In the previous match against Australia, India posted 330 runs on the board in 48.5 overs as Pratika Rawal and Smriti Mandhana scored a half-century each. However, Australia reached the target of 331 runs in 49 overs with the help of Alyssa Healy’s 142 off 107 as they won the match by three wickets.
Let’s look at the probable playing XI of India for Match 20 against England in the Women’s World Cup 2025-
Top Order: Pratika Rawal, Smriti Mandhana, and Harleen Deol

Pratika Rawal, Smriti Mandhana, and Harleen Deol will likely be a part of the top order in the playing 11. Rawal is the leading run-scorer for India in the tournament with 180 runs in four games at a strike rate of 72.58.
Middle Order: Harmanpreet Kaur (c), Jemimah Rodrigues, and Deepti Sharma

Harmanpreet Kaur, Jemimah Rodrigues, and Deepti Sharma could be there in the middle order. Deepti has taken nine wickets in four games at an average of 22.77 and is the highest wicket-taker for the team.
Lower Middle Order: Richa Ghosh (wk) and Amanjot Kaur

Richa Ghosh and Amanjot Kaur are likely to be a part of the lower middle order. Richa is the second-highest run-scorer for India with 163 runs in four games at a strike rate of 130.40.
Bowlers: Sneh Rana, Kranti Gaud, and Shree Charani

Sneh Rana, Kranti Gaud, and Shree Charani will likely be the three bowlers for the team. Charani and Gaud have taken six wickets each so far.
